How do you know if someone received your message on Facebook?

The blue circle with the check next to your message means that your message was sent. A filled-in blue circle next to your message means that your message was delivered. And, when a friend has read your message, a small version of your friend's photo will appear next to your message.

Why would a message on Messenger not be delivered?

If you send a message to someone and the message is not delivered, meaning that only an unfilled check mark icon appears, it generally means one of two things: The user has not logged into Facebook. The user has blocked you on Messenger.

What does a GREY circle with a white check mark mean on Messenger?

Filled Grey Circle with a White Tick

This is the icon, on Facebook Messenger that shows your message has been delivered to the other end. However, you must understand that the word 'delivered' here, does not necessarily mean that the recipient has 'read' the message.

What does one grey tick mean on Messenger?

A single grey tick means that your message hasn't been delivered, which might mean you've been blocked… though it might also mean that the person you're sending it to hasn't been able to receive the message yet (e.g. if their phone is off), so by itself it isn't an indication.

Can you tell if someone blocked me on Messenger?

However, you can infer that you've been blocked on Messenger from the state of the status icon on a message you've sent. If you send a message to someone and the message is not delivered, meaning an unfilled check mark icon appears, you may have been blocked.
